DP tuner speedometer ?

I have a F250 with 35" tires. The speedometer was never recalibrated and i have a DP tuner chip on the way. Has any of you guys ran a dp tuner or other chip without getting the speedometer corrected or is it something that is really important to do before i install the chip. Thanks for the help guys.

The tires size is calibration is in the gem or abs module under the personality heading. At least on an 02 took forever to find it

But ron is right the shift points will be different if you dont do anything. Might be a small issue if you tow, otherwise youll have your foot it it so much i dont think it will matter.

you can fix the speed signal using a inline correction device, speed wizard, truspeed, accuspeed etc...

"shift points" do not change as much as everybody makes it seem, most the transmissions in the superduty base their shifting off of rpm and load, not speed
